Hi All,

I am new. looking for some input. I got a TRX250EX, an am running 660 rear shock and 4-6lb in the tires. I LOVE the quick nimble performance of the sporr quad I have. I DO NOT enjoy the jarring abuse while riding. I am 46, 160lb with some minor spine issues, and looking for something sporty but the that won't beat me to death. I only trail ride in Florida. I have been looking at trx700xx(IRS+weight), KFX700(weight), and some one mentioned a DS(mot sure which model) due to stock adjustability and ergonomics.

I gues I could drop 2k on elka front and back, but it would still be a "250" LOL

Any insight would be greatly appreciated

Another ride you might consider is a Can-Am Renegade 570. Light and nimble handling, for a sport/utility quad, but comfortable IRS suspension in the rear. Son had one with a 500. I wish I had the money to buy it when he got his Scrambler 1000. Was a fun ride.
